In baseball and many other sports there is a huge conspiracy of silence that has gone on and continues today. I am convinced NOBODY is really willing to confront the problem of drugs in sport head on. I will use baseball as an example. Coaches, trainers, owners, general managers all knew or strongly suspected what was going on. The approach was “if we ignore the problem it will go away.” In baseball there is a culture of tolerance for drugs in the form of alcohol and amphetamines.

I am really interested to see who Mitchell has talked in his inquiry. Have they talked to Jason Giambi’s personal trainer who had to know what was going on? Have they talked to everyone involved with the Texas Rangers during the Juan Gonzales era? Have they talked to all the team trainers, assistant trainers, conditioning coaches and clubhouse people? I suspect not. Why because they do not want to know how deep the problem is.
